            Re: Hi riders please help me to select cbr150 or r15

            Wait a second, wait a second, what is this. . ? If you want pillion comfort, go for CBR150R or else go for R15, seriously come on guys are these both meant for just comfort. . ? Now as I have ridden both the 150R and R15 for some time, I can definitely vouch for the CBR150R, let me just pour in my ride review in terms of points, let me start off with R15,

            1. Eye catcher. . .
            2. Aggressive seating posture. . .
            3. Best tires. . .
            4. Best handler. . .
            5. Powerful brakes. . .
            6. Sucking rear seats. . .
            7. Average FE. . .
            8. Sticky tires. . .
            9. Good for city and tracks. . .

            Now coming to 150R,
            1. It too is an eye catchy, especially the orange colour is the best looking. . .
            2. Best handler too. . .
            3. Powerful brakes. . .
            4. Good riding posture, not too leaning, not to commuterish, just perfect. . .
            5. Compared to R15, better in terms of handling, can change directions easily as compared to R15, ride it and you'll know what I mean. . .
            6. They say it's more costlier than R15 but people forget that CBR is technically advanced than R15, . .
            7. They say switch gears, blah blah blah sucks, come on, it's just a reason to hate it. . .
            8. Good for highways and tracks. . .
            9. Medium rubber. . .
            10. Not so suitable if you are going in a congested traffic, you'll be pissed off. . .
            11. More FE compared to R15. . .
            12. Better pillion comfort. . .

            So my final wordings,
            CBR is definitely faster, quicker, sharp handler, easy going and high speed cruiser. . . Only place it's going to make you suck is in bumper to bumper traffic, if you ride all day in this kind of place then just go for R15, else CBR is the bike you need. . . Performance, performance and performance are what these two motorcycles are all about, both are tough to choose between but looking at the spec sheet and the performance list, the CBR scores a bit more but coming to other things like switch gears, tires and other stuffs, R15 is definitely a clear winner. . . That's it, the rest is your choice now. . .
